Corporate Policy
Spectrum is committed to delivering high-quality fiber internet services while ensuring customer satisfaction and data security. To achieve this, the following policies and practices are strictly implemented:
- Blocking Options – Protect against unauthorized third-party charges on your Spectrum bill.
- California Privacy Policy – Explains how customer data is collected, used, and protected under California law.
- Commercial Internet Acceptable Use Policy (AUP) – Defines acceptable usage for Spectrum Fiber Internet services, ensuring fair and lawful access.
- Consumer Broadband Labels – Offers transparency about broadband performance and service plans.
- Customer Proprietary Network Information (CPNI) Form – Protects personal data, including internet and phone usage details, while respecting customer privacy.
- Do Not Call Policy – Gives customers the ability to block unwanted marketing calls.
- Email Disclaimer – Sets clear guidelines and limitations for email communications.
- Spectrum Broadband Fair Access Policy – Promotes equitable network usage to maintain optimal service for all customers.
- Subpoena Compliance – Outlines Spectrum’s legal process for responding to subpoenas involving customer data.
- Local Carrier Freeze Form – Safeguards against unauthorized changes to your local service provider.
- Network Management Policy – Details how Spectrum manages its network to ensure reliability and security.
- State-Specific Complaint Filing Policies – Guides customers in filing service complaints based on their location.
- Emergency Management Plans – Demonstrates Spectrum’s commitment to maintaining service during emergencies.
- Customer Rights and Responsibilities – Educates customers about their rights and obligations concerning Spectrum’s services.
- Privacy Policy – Ensures Spectrum does not sell or track individual browsing history while maintaining robust data protection measures.
- Residential Internet Acceptable Use Policy (AUP) – Outlines proper and lawful usage of Spectrum Residential and Fiber Internet services.
- Social Media Code of Conduct – Establishes respectful and responsible interactions on Spectrum’s social media platforms.
With these policies, Spectrum prioritizes customer satisfaction, fairness, and privacy while providing reliable fiber internet services.
